Access Denied

You don't have permission to access "http://www.picknsave.com/p/del-monte-no-salt-added-sweet-peas/0002400000142?" on this server.

Reference #18.f2c83017.1711712085.ba65fe9

https://errors.edgesuite.net/18.f2c83017.1711712085.ba65fe9